Motherhood Is Just One Big Escape Room
I used to work for an escape room company, and it was a lot of fun. When I went on maternity leave, I realised my whole life had become one big escape room with a challenge around every corner. That’s when I decided not to go back.

My Story . AI-Generated.
I was born in Haiti, a place full of beauty and struggle, carrying a dream that many children take for granted—to have both of my parents by my side. For most of my life, that dream was only a longing. Though both of my parents were alive, I grew up without them. They left me in Haiti when I was just one year old, and from that moment on, I learned what it meant to live without a mother’s embrace or a father’s guidance.

Back to School Made Easier With Family Friendly TTRPGs
The school year has begun and for many parents the evenings feel shorter than ever. Dinner, homework, after school activities, and chores all compete for attention. Parents often feel like time is slipping away while children feel overwhelmed or neglected. Instead of family time, evenings can turn into a battlefield of reminders, negotiations, and frustration.
